Cement Foundation Installation in Charleston, SC
Cement foundation installation is a key service for property owners planning new construction, additions, or renovations that require a stable base. This process involves preparing the site, pouring concrete, and ensuring the foundation is level and durable to support structures such as homes, garages, sheds, or patios. Property owners often request this service when building on uneven or unstable ground, or when replacing an existing foundation that has become compromised. Understanding the scope of the project, including the type of foundation needed and any site-specific conditions, is essential before requesting installation services.
Homeowners typically want to know about the different types of foundations available, such as slab, pier, or basement foundations, and how each suits their property and future plans. It’s also important to consider factors like soil conditions, drainage, and local building codes that can influence the foundation’s design and installation process. Clear communication about project requirements and site assessments can help ensure the foundation is properly installed to provide long-lasting support for the structure.

Cement Foundation Installation Questions
What types of projects require a cement foundation? Foundations are essential for structures like garages, decks, sheds, and additions to ensure stability and support.
How deep should a cement foundation be installed? The depth depends on soil conditions and the type of structure, but typically it extends below the frost line for stability.
What preparation is needed before installing a cement foundation? Proper site grading, clearing, and ensuring a level base are important steps before pouring concrete.
What materials are used for cement foundation installation? Concrete mix combined with reinforcement like rebar or wire mesh is standard for durable foundations.
